Opinion: Tottenham player ratings from the 2-0 win over Brentford

Tottenham Hotspur made it back-to-back wins in the Premier League this evening with a 2-0 victory over Brentford in N17.

Let’s take a look at how the individual players got on:

Hugo Lloris – 7 – Not Hugo’s most commanding performance. There were a few iffy moments when coming off his line and distributing short-range passes. But, at the end of the day, he made the saves he needed to make.

Emerson Royal – 7.5 – Really impressed with the engine on this guy. He has no problem getting up and down that wing all day long. Just needs to work on his final third play.

Davinson Sanchez – 7 – A tidy performance from the Colombian after his nightmare against Mura. Good underlaps to offer support and capable at the back.

Eric Dier – 8 – Dier is coming into his own in that central role. He steps out and presses really well, while also covering smartly when others go forward and winning aerial balls.

Ben Davies – 8 – We’ll give him some generous credit for the goal. Davies’ all-around play today was fantastic though. Not only is he looking solid at the back, but he is contributing with underlaps in the attack too.

Sergio Reguilon – 8.5 – This man is getting better and better by the game. The energy is there. The fitness is there. The effort is there. It’s just consistency with his final ball in certain situations. Got one assist, could have had two or three. Superb though.

Oliver Skipp – 9 – Another fantastic performance from the youngster. He works tirelessly to turn the ball over, keep it, and use it positively. Looks the real all-around package.

Pierre-Emile Hojbjerg – 8 – He is building a great partnership with Skipp where Hojbjerg pushes forward and joins attacks more. For a defensive midfielder, he is very good in the final third. Another tidy performance.

Heung-min Son – 9 – A great ball into the box for the first goal and was there to tap home the second. Definitely his best game under Conte so far. He seems to be getting used to his new number 10/pocket role.

Lucas Moura – 7.5 – A great player to have for that high press as he will run for you all day long. Hit and miss with his final ball again today, but caused problems and won the ball back a lot.

Harry Kane – 8 – Another nearly day for Harry in front of goal, but the rest of his game was superb. Great build up play, created the second goal, held the ball up well. I have no problems with the way he is playing.

Substitutes: 

Harry Winks – 6 – Came on to see the game out and worked hard.
